Top Barcode Label Printing Technologies in China: A Comprehensive Overview

Barcode label printing in China has advanced significantly, driven by technological innovations and market demand. A recent industry report indicates that the global barcode label market is projected to reach $45 billion by 2025, with China being a major contributor. These labels are vital for various sectors, including retail, logistics, and manufacturing.

The printing technologies in China include thermal transfer, direct thermal, and inkjet printing. Each method has its strengths and weaknesses. Thermal transfer printing is known for its durability, making it suitable for long-term applications. However, it may not be ideal for all environments. Direct thermal printing is cost-effective but has limitations in print longevity. Inkjet technology offers high-resolution images but can sometimes be inconsistent in ink quality.

Despite these advancements, challenges remain in quality control and production efficiency. Many companies are still grappling with ensuring consistent output and minimizing waste. As the demand for high-quality barcode labels rises, addressing these issues is crucial for maintaining competitiveness. The evolving landscape indicates a need for continuous improvement and innovation in barcode label technologies.

Market Trends in China's Barcode Label Industry: Key Drivers and Statistics

The barcode label industry in China is experiencing notable growth. According to industry reports, the market size reached approximately $4 billion in 2022. This represents a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of about 8% from 2018 to 2022. The increase is attributed to the rising demand for automation in various sectors. E-commerce and retail are major drivers of this trend. More companies are adopting barcode systems to enhance inventory management.

Statistics show that over 70% of logistics companies in China now utilize barcode tracking. This technology improves efficiency by reducing errors in product handling. The adoption rate is higher in urban areas where logistics operations are denser. However, there remain challenges in rural regions. The infrastructure is often less developed, leading to potential delays in implementation.

Several factors influence market dynamics. Awareness of counterfeit goods drives demand for secure labeling. Regulatory changes also compel businesses to improve traceability. Despite the growth, the industry faces pressure to innovate. Companies must explore newer technologies like RFID and smart labels to stay competitive. This competition could lead to more sustainable practices.

Sustainability in Barcode Label Production: Eco-Friendly Practices in China

Sustainability is becoming essential in barcode label production. Many producers in China are adopting eco-friendly practices to meet global demands. According to a recent report by the Sustainable Packaging Coalition, nearly 70% of consumers prefer sustainable packaging. This trend drives companies to rethink their production methods.

Water-based inks and biodegradable materials are gaining traction. These alternatives reduce harmful chemicals in production. For instance, using recycled paper for labels can save trees and reduce waste. The Global Label Market Report estimates that eco-friendly labels will make up over 30% of the market by 2026. While progress is evident, challenges remain. The transition to sustainable practices can be costly. Small businesses may struggle to afford eco-friendly materials.

Education and investment in green technologies are crucial. Training employees about sustainability can enhance production lines. Industry experts note that collaboration among stakeholders could boost innovation. Despite the push for sustainability, many manufacturers still rely on traditional methods. The gap between standards and practices calls for reflection and improvement.
